If you're of a certain age - you may remember the craziness of Cabbage Patch dolls. These dolls were developed in 1978 by a young art student, and became one of the most popular toy fads.
So, when I was asked to create a card this week for a little lady's first birthday featuring Cabbage Patch I was in.
Happy First Birthday Briah!!!
The image is from a free download colouring book, printed on Xpress It Copic paper and coloured with Copic markers. I fussy cut the image and used foam tape to pop her off the page.
The sentiment comes from Birthday Bash, and the balloons from Artistry cricut cartridges.
I continued the balloons inside the card and tied with some retired waxy flax.
The patterned paper is from Confetti Wishes (retired) from CTMH. Every little girl likes bling so I added purple sparkly hearts to her cupcake and balloon.
I decided to only colour in the "1" on the card to not make it too busy.
I couldn't be happier with the final project and it is now Gramma approved and off to the party!!!
